A man has been charged after police negotiators attended a disturbance in Paisley on Friday.

Emergency services were called to a property in the Renfrewshire town at around 3pm following reports of an incident.

Officers have charged a 39-year-old man in connection with the incident. He is due to appear at Paisley Sheriff Court on Monday.

A Police Scotland spokesperson said: “Around 3pm on Friday, October 3, 2025, police received a report of a man causing a disturbance within a property in Paisley.

“Officers, including police negotiators, attended, and a 39-year-old man was arrested and charged in connection with the incident. He is due to appear at Paisley Sheriff Court on Monday, October 6, 2025.”
